Globally,  we drink about 188 billion liters of beer each year, enough to fill over 75,000 Olympic-sized swimming pools! But this much beloved drink comes with a serious environmental footprint: a single pint of beer requires 8-10 pints of water and large amounts of energy to make.

So how can we enjoy beer without harming the planet? In this episode, we speak with Felix James, co-founder of London-based Small Beer Brew Co, to learn about how beer is made and how companies like his are making good beer at a fraction of the environmental cost.
